Passionfruit helps companies answer complex questionnaires at scale, especially in sustainability, quality, and compliance reporting. To do this effectively, it structures its domain around a few core concepts. Understanding these concepts will help you make the most of Passionfruit.

Questionnaires

A Questionnaire is the core unit of work in Passionfruit. It represents a set of questions a company needs to answer—often coming from sustainability frameworks like CDP, CSRD, EcoVadis, or customer-specific audits.

A questionnaire in Passionfruit can be:

  • Created manually
  • Generated based on previous templates
  • An Excel, Word or browser form.

Every questionnaire is uniquely identified and versioned, enabling teams to track changes over time and reuse previous work.

Questions & Answers

Each questionnaire consists of multiple Questions, which can be:

  • Free text questions
  • Multiple-choice questions
  • Tables or matrix-style inputs
  • Numeric fields
  • File uploads or evidence requirements

Answers are stored alongside questions. Passionfruit ensures:

  • All answers are tracked with metadata (who answered, when, and with what evidence)
  • Versioning to maintain historical records
  • Semantic mapping so similar questions can be recognized across questionnaires

Approved Answer Library

Passionfruit maintains an Approved Answer Library. This is a knowledge base of previously vetted answers that can be reused in new questionnaires.

Benefits of the library:

  • Speeds up questionnaire completion
  • Ensures consistency in responses
  • Reduces errors and omissions
  • Stores references to supporting documents (e.g. policies, reports)

Whenever Passionfruit recognizes that a question is similar to a past one, it can suggest an answer from the library for review.

Knowledge base

Many questionnaires require Evidence — documents, spreadsheets, certificates, or policies that substantiate the answers. Passionfruit manages evidence as first-class objects:

  • Stored in dedicated evidence buckets (e.g. S3)
  • Version-controlled to ensure the latest documents are used
  • Linked directly to questions and answers
  • Health-checked for validity, approval status, and expiry dates

Evidence integrity is critical for audits and regulatory compliance.

Workflows

Passionfruit structures the process of completing questionnaires into Workflows, supporting:

  • Drafting and reviewing answers
  • Tagging questions for team members
  • Tracking progress across large questionnaires
  • Managing approval cycles

Workflows help teams collaborate and ensure that complex submissions are completed accurately and on time.

Automation & AI

A major goal of Passionfruit is to reduce the manual work involved in questionnaire answering. It uses AI for:

  • Semantic search: finding similar past questions
  • Answer generation: drafting responses based on past answers and documents
  • Formatting answers into required structures (e.g. tables, free text)
  • Confidence scoring to signal how reliable an auto-suggested answer might be

Even when using AI, Passionfruit keeps humans in the loop. Users always review and approve suggested answers.
